Performance … WebApr 6, 2024 · Tenacity (mesotrione) is the first herbicide that results in rapid, easy to visualize reductions in weedy perennial grasses, including creeping bentgrass. Best control, according to most research of creeping bentgrass, is achieved if three applications are made on 14-21 day intervals. Mesotrione has excellent safety on Kentucky bluegrass and ...

WebSep 12, 2016 · Creeping jenny will grow in any average soil and in sun or shade, though we think it stands out more in shade, lighting up shady areas of the garden. It will tolerate damp soil however is quite drought tolerant, only requiring supplemental irrigation during drought. When growing in sun it requires more consistent moisture.

WebPerennial ryegrass grows best in cooler climates. It tolerates foot traffic well and germinates quickly. Unlike other grasses, it isn’t especially thirsty. Water your ryegrass moderately and enjoy a soft, dark green lawn kids and pets will love year after year.
